We are seeking a dedicated support pedagogue for our brand new daily activities program, which will soon open on Malörtsvägen in Trelleborg.
Here, you will find an exciting workplace consisting of two groups where you will have the opportunity to make a real difference.
Daily activities is an initiative for adults with intellectual disabilities and/or autism or acquired brain injuries who are of working age and are not employed or studying. The mission is to offer meaningful engagement, where the initiative is designed and adapted based on the individual's interests and needs, with a focus on enhancing the individual's ability to become more independent.
Responsibilities
As a support pedagogue, in addition to the core mission, you will have a special responsibility to guide and mentor colleagues in pedagogical and user-centered work. You will work closely with colleagues to introduce, teach, and follow up on methods and approaches that meet each user's individual needs, while providing continuous feedback and support in daily activities.
You will guide the establishment, follow-up, and development of implementation plans and plan daily work based on these. You are responsible for creating clear and quality-assured routines and job descriptions, as well as ensuring they are followed in practice.
An important part of the role is to actively monitor new methods, approaches, and tools for the target group and translate this knowledge into methodological guidance that strengthens both colleagues' competencies and the quality of the service.
With a foundation in good and clear communication as well as a positive approach, your task is to create calm and security for users, regardless of the situation. Furthermore, you will provide support and create conditions for good contact with important connections for the individual. Within the internal organization, you will primarily collaborate with other support pedagogues, support assistants, and the section manager to continuously develop the service and achieve set goals.
The core mission involves daily support and guidance for users based on a pedagogical and practical approach in their engagement. The aim is for users to achieve increased independence and realize the highest possible quality and participation in their daily activities.
As a support pedagogue, you will be placed in one of the daily activities groups but will also serve as a pedagogical resource for the entire operation and for daily activities as a whole. Qualifications
For the role of support pedagogue, we are looking for someone who has:
- Education as a support pedagogue (400 YH); other post-secondary vocational training (minimum 200 YH) or higher education (minimum 60 credits) in a relevant field such as pedagogy, psychiatry, behavioral science, or social work.
- Experience in support for individuals with disabilities (LSS), having worked with people with intellectual disabilities, autism spectrum disorders, or mental health issues. Through your experience, you can demonstrate that you work safely and methodically with low-arousal approaches, clear pedagogical methods, and alternative and augmentative communication (AAC).
- Good computer skills and experience with documentation.
- Strong ability to express yourself well in spoken and written Swedish due to interaction and social documentation.
- A valid B driver's license for manual transmission vehicles.
